Just bought a moses basket and surprised that the mattress is covered in a plasticy waterproof material. Is this standard? Does this not increase risk of suffocation?

Also is is best to use terry towling or jersey fitted sheets?

And as for cellular blankets - I'm guessing cotton is much better than any kind of acrylic ones?

Any advice welcomed as only just starting to look into bedding! Thank you!
 
I am going to put a pillow case round my moses basket mattress fits perfect sounds cheap but does the job!!
 
Ive folded a flat cot sheet in half and used that for my moses basket! Couldnt really justify buying the small sheets as they wouldnt be used for long.
